Heat shrinkable tubing with a retraction rate of 3:1
What shrink ratio 3:1 Means ?
The desired characteristic of a heat shrinkable tubing is its ability to shrink in diameter under the effect of heat. Thus, heat shrinkable tubing with an initial internal diameter of 39 mm and a shrink ratio of 3:1, will see its diameter to the minimum restrained take the value of 13 mm.
More shrink ratio is important, i.e. greater than 2:1, the more the choice must be motivated by the need to restrain the tubing with distant diameters, including shrink ratio (the largest diameter divided by the smallest diameter) is greater than 2.
To complete this feature of tightened 3:1, manufacturers of tubing thermo-retrenchable sheaths are available with complementary tightness ratios such as the Restricted 1.2:1, Restricted 1.5:1, Restricted 2:1, Restricted 4:1 for fine walls, Restricted 6:1 for thick-walled sheaths with strong tight adhesive.
Example of a tubing with a shrink ratio of 3:1 : the dual wall tubing ratio 3:1 with adhesive model PF3-A
The heat shrinkable tubing PF3-A is a tubing With a round section in polyolethin cross-linked with EVA co-extruded adhesive, designed to ensure both insulation and sealing. Sound shrink ratio 3:1 allows to cover large diameter deviations while ensuring homogeneous clamping and excellent mechanical hold thanks to the internal resin. Waterproof after retraction, it operates from -55 °C to +135 °C, with complete retraction from 110 °C (beginning at 70 °C). Equipped with 20 kV/mm dielectric rigidity, flame retardant and VW-1 class (self-extinguishing except transparent version), it meets MIL-SPEC SAE-AMS-DTL-23053/5 classes 1 and 2. UV-resistant (excluding transparent), RoHS-compliant and REACH-compliant, it has a matt appearance, without marking, with very good flexibility and controlled longitudinal reduction (-15 % to +1 %).
In the case of a main beam coming out of an outer box, the thin-wall heat shrink tubing double adhesive in ratio 3:1 Ø39 mm is positioned before the final connection, then retracted to descend to about 13 mm. This high reduction rate allows to encompass both the main cable and the connection area (brush or splice), even in the presence of a larger connector. During heating, the polyoleumthin contract while the co-extruded adhesive melts and fills the gaps, creating a barrier Waterproof against moisture, dust and projections. After cooling, the assembly forms a sleeve mechanically reinforced, which secures the connection while ensuring reliable and durable electrical insulation.
